Step 1: Understanding the Basics
Before you begin, it’s essential to grasp the fundamentals of linking Aadhaar with mobile. The Unique Identification Authority of India (UIDAI) allows you to associate your mobile number with your Aadhaar profile. This linkage enables two-factor authentication (2FA) for services such as online banking, e-commerce, and government portals. It also supports e-KYC processes, making it easier to open bank accounts, obtain loans, or enroll in subsidies.
Key terms to know:
- Aadhaar Number (UID) – a 12-digit unique identifier.
- Mobile Number – a valid 10-digit Indian mobile number.
- OTP (One-Time Password) – a 6-digit code sent via SMS for verification.
- 2FA (Two-Factor Authentication) – a security mechanism combining something you know (password) and something you have (mobile).
- e-KYC – electronic Know Your Customer, used for verifying identity digitally.

Step 4: Troubleshooting and Optimization
Even with a straightforward process, users often encounter hiccups. Here are common issues and how to resolve them:
- OTP Not Received: Verify that your mobile number is correct, active, and can receive SMS. If you’re in a rural area, network congestion may delay messages. Try again after a few minutes.
- Incorrect Aadhaar Number: Double-check for typos. If you’re still unable to link, visit an Aadhaar enrollment center for assistance.
- Mobile Number Already Linked: If the number is linked to another Aadhaar, you’ll need to unlink it first. Go to the UIDAI portal, select “Unlink Aadhaar from Mobile Number,†and follow the prompts.
- Data Privacy Concerns: The UIDAI strictly adheres to data protection laws. However, if you suspect any misuse, report it to the UIDAI helpdesk immediately.
